#3f302f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f302f is composed of 24.7% red, 18.8%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.8% magenta, 25.4%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 14.5% and a lightness of 21.6%. #3f302f color hex could be obtained by blending #7e605e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#3f302f color description : Very dark grayish red.
#3f302f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f302f has RGB values of R:63, G:48,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.25,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 4141103.
